Each of the two sonatas recorded in this sixth volume of the series with Alain Planès demonstrates in its own way a compositional process peculiar to Schubert. The first of them, D.568, is the final version, probably from late on in his life, of a sonata that he had abandoned in June 1817, when he was just twenty. At the end of May 1825, Schubert put the finishing touches to another sonata, in A minor, the first he intended for publication. Here the composer generally dodges the conventional polarities so as to create an organic antithesis to the brusque dialectics of Beethoven, by saturating the piano's sonorities, by constant changes in perspective, by insidious modification of colours. 'Schubert, that master of subtle ambivalence, ceases to be intelligible each time his discourse becomes affirmative.'
(Roman Hinke)
